Transaction 3efd156e8e483dd8d018681a7eda1f92409901e32130a9c454ac8be9eaf01806
1 Input
1 Output
-
3efd156e8e483dd8d018681a7eda1f92409901e32130a9c454ac8be9eaf01806:0
- value
- 191826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7386410f1433ec8d9e35dd229580722773f7e9dd OP_EQUAL
- address
- 3CDrTkB2pqGPhnpddprTrK6teHoTH8EfJa